    Default Amazing new Cadillac Wheels

    I think I mentioned these were coming down the pike soon in some other thread...anyway:



    56mm, 92a, take cartridge bearings, and produced by Madrid, which owns the licensing name for Cadillac Wheels (from Nasworthy) and Cadillac trucks.
